Magnetic Touch wrote:
VituVingiSana wrote:
KK, KPLC, Williamson, Unga will all make very good profits but the prices will lag the profitability!

Thanks for your candid response. Are you still holding KQ? It does not appear among the above.
Yes. Why? Coz at 37, it remains 'cheap'. I expect excellent profits for FY 2010-11.

Also the 'depreciation' of the KES means the NAV will jump since KQ holds lots of cash in forex [US$] as well as planes [value exceeds loans]...
